服务器证书过期快速解决方案及预防措施
卡尔云官网
www.kaeryun.com
1. 服务器证书过期怎么办
1.1 什么是服务器证书
简单来说,服务器证书就像一个身份证,它证明你的服务器是可靠的,用户可以信任它。它由一个证书颁发机构(CA)签发,里面包含了服务器的信息,比如域名、公钥等。当用户访问你的服务器时,他们的浏览器会检查这个证书是否有效。
1.2 服务器证书过期的风险
如果服务器证书过期了,会出现几个问题。首先,用户可能会看到警告信息,比如“此网站的安全证书已过期”。这会让人怀疑网站的安全性,导致用户离开。更严重的是,如果攻击者利用这个漏洞,他们可能会盗取用户的信息。
1.3 发现证书过期后的应对措施
一旦发现证书过期,首先要做的是立即更换证书。这涉及到以下几个步骤:
- 停止使用过期的证书:确保服务器不再使用过期的证书。
- 生成新的证书:你可以通过证书颁发机构(CA)或者本地CA生成新的证书。
- 安装新的证书:将新证书安装到服务器上。
- 更新相关的配置:确保所有的配置文件都指向新的证书。
- 通知用户:如果可能的话,通知用户你的网站已经修复了证书问题。
记住,及时更换证书是保护用户信息和网站安全的关键步骤。
2. 如何重新生成服务器证书
2.1 生成新证书的准备工作
当你的服务器证书过期后,第一步就是准备生成新的证书。这需要以下几个步骤:
备份当前证书和私钥:在生成新证书之前,确保备份好当前的证书和私钥。这是非常重要的,因为私钥是安全的关键。
确定证书颁发机构(CA):你需要选择一个可靠的证书颁发机构(CA)。有很多知名的CA,如Let's Encrypt、GlobalSign等。
准备必要的证书信息:这通常包括你的域名、组织信息、国家代码等。
2.2 使用证书颁发机构(CA)生成新证书
使用CA生成新证书通常包括以下步骤:
生成CSR(证书签名请求):CSR是一个包含你的公钥和证书信息的文件。你需要使用一个工具来生成它,比如OpenSSL。
提交CSR到CA:将CSR提交给CA。CA会验证你的信息,并检查你的域名所有权。
等待CA签发证书:一旦CA验证了你的信息,他们会签发一个新的证书。
下载并安装证书:CA签发证书后,你会收到一个文件。你需要将其下载并安装到你的服务器上。
2.3 本地CA生成新证书的步骤
如果你不想使用外部CA,也可以使用本地CA来生成证书。以下是步骤:
设置本地CA:首先,你需要设置一个本地CA。这通常涉及到安装CA软件,并生成CA的私钥和证书。
生成CSR:与使用外部CA类似,你需要生成一个CSR。
请求证书:使用本地CA的私钥来签名CSR,生成新证书。
安装证书:将新证书安装到你的服务器上。
记住,无论是使用外部CA还是本地CA,生成新证书的关键是确保整个过程的安全性。私钥必须保密,CSR的传输和存储也必须安全。
3. 服务器证书过期后如何续费
3.1 认识服务器证书续费的重要性
服务器证书,简单来说,就是网站的身份证,确保用户访问的是真正的网站,而不是被篡改的假冒网站。当这个“身份证”过期后,如果不及时续费,就会给网站带来一系列的风险,比如用户可能会看到不信任的警告信息,这可能会影响网站的信誉和用户访问量。所以,理解服务器证书续费的重要性是至关重要的。
3.2 检查证书到期日期
首先,你得知道你的服务器证书什么时候到期。这通常可以在证书的详细信息中找到,或者通过你的证书管理工具查看。一旦你知道了到期日期,就得开始规划续费的事宜。
3.3 选择合适的续费服务提供商
选择一个可靠的证书服务提供商至关重要。市面上有很多CA,它们提供的证书类型和服务各不相同。以下是一些选择提供商时可以考虑的因素:
- 服务稳定性:选择一个历史悠久的CA,它们的服务更稳定。
- 价格:比较不同CA的价格,但不要只看价格,服务质量同样重要。
- 支持服务:好的CA会提供24/7的客户支持,这在遇到问题时非常有用。
- 证书类型:确保提供商能提供你需要的证书类型,比如EV SSL、Wildcard SSL等。
3.4 续费流程与注意事项
续费流程通常很简单,以下是一些步骤和注意事项:
登录CA网站:使用你的账户登录到CA的网站。
选择证书:在账户管理界面,找到你的证书,并选择续费选项。
确认续费信息:仔细检查续费信息,包括证书到期日期、续费时长和费用。
支付费用:按照提示完成支付流程。确保使用安全的支付方式。
下载新证书:支付完成后,CA会发送新证书给你。下载并安装到你的服务器上。
注意事项:
- 备份旧证书:在续费之前,备份你的旧证书和私钥。
- 更新服务器配置:安装新证书后,确保更新服务器配置以使用新证书。
- 测试配置:在部署新证书之前,测试网站以确认证书正常工作。
总之,服务器证书过期后,续费是一个简单但必须完成的步骤。通过正确的续费流程和选择合适的CA,你可以确保你的网站始终保持安全可靠。
4. 预防和监控证书过期的策略
4.1 定期检查证书有效期
预防证书过期,第一步就是要定期检查证书的有效期。这就像定期检查汽车的油量一样,虽然看似简单,但非常重要。你可以通过以下几种方式来检查:
- 证书管理界面:大多数CA都提供了一个用户界面,你可以登录后查看证书的状态和到期日期。
- 命令行工具:如果你更习惯使用命令行,可以使用如
openssl
这样的工具来检查证书的到期日期。 - 自动化脚本:编写一个简单的脚本,定期运行,自动检查所有证书的有效期。
4.2 自动续费设置
手动检查证书有效期虽然可行,但很容易忘记。因此,设置自动续费是一个很好的预防措施。大多数CA都提供了自动续费选项:
- CA提供的自动续费服务:一些CA允许你设置自动续费,一旦证书接近到期,它们会自动为你续费。
- 第三方续费服务:市面上也有一些第三方服务可以帮你管理证书续费。
4.3 监控工具的使用
除了自动续费,使用监控工具也是预防证书过期的有效策略。这些工具可以:
- 实时监控证书状态:一旦检测到证书状态异常,比如即将过期,系统会立即通知你。
- 集成到现有的IT管理系统中:这样,你可以在一个统一的平台上管理所有的证书。
4.4 应急预案制定与演练
即便有了所有预防措施,也不能保证证书永远不会过期。因此,制定一个应急预案是非常必要的。以下是一些关键步骤:
- 备份证书:定期备份你的证书和私钥,以防万一。
- 快速响应流程:当证书过期时,有一个明确的流程来快速更换证书。
- 演练:定期进行演练,确保你的团队知道如何在证书过期时迅速行动。
总结一下,预防服务器证书过期需要综合考虑多个方面。通过定期检查、自动续费、使用监控工具和制定应急预案,你可以大大降低证书过期带来的风险,确保你的网站始终保持安全可靠。
卡尔云官网
www.kaeryun.com